Russian military launched a missile attack near the city of Sumy in northeastern Ukraine on the 6th of May. The attack resulted in the tragic deaths of three individuals, including a child, with approximately 10 others sustaining injuries. This recent assault comes as tensions continue to escalate in the region, with Sumy having previously been targeted by a ballistic missile in April.
The conflict in Ukraine has been a longstanding issue, with territorial disputes and political tensions between Russia and Ukraine dating back several years. The recent escalation of violence in Sumy has raised concerns internationally, as the impact of such attacks on civilian populations remains a critical issue.
